  • Lake Towada: A picturesque lake surrounded by lush landscapes, Lake Towada offers a tranquil atmosphere perfect for romantic outings or leisurely strolls along its beach. Enjoy breathtaking scenery, especially during the cherry blossom season or autumn foliage, making it a photographer's paradise.
  • Oyu Stone Circle: This archaeological site is steeped in cultural significance, with mysterious stone arrangements that spark curiosity about ancient rituals. A visit here provides insights into the region's rich history and an opportunity to reflect on the past.
  • Oirase Gorge: Renowned for its stunning natural beauty, Oirase Gorge features a meandering river flanked by lush greenery and cascading waterfalls. Ideal for outdoor enthusiasts, it offers scenic hiking trails that immerse visitors in the serene surroundings.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Oyu Onsen

Travelling to Oyu Onsen can be conveniently done via several major airports. Misawa Airport (MSJ) is situated 66.0km away, with nearby accommodation options such as the 3.5-star Hoshino Resorts Aomoriya, 4.8km from the airport, and the 3-star Hotel Route-Inn Misawa, just 1.6km away. Akita Airport (AXT), located 91.7km from Oyu Onsen, offers hotels including the 3.5-star ANA Crowne Plaza Akita and Richmond Hotel Akita Ekimae, both 14.5km away. Aomori Airport (AOJ) is 31.6kms distant, with options like the 3.5-star Minamida Onsen Hotel Apple Land, 19.3km from the airport, and the 3-star Richmond Hotel Aomori, 11.3km away.

What's the weather like in Oyu Onsen?
The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 64°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 24°F. The rainiest months in Oyu Onsen are July, August, September, and October, with each month seeing an average of 9 inches of rainfall.
